c语言lu
Ⅰ 在c语言里有哪些数据类型
C语言中的数据类型:一、基本类型二、构造类型三、指针类型四、空类型其中基本类型有:整型、字符型、实型(浮点型)、枚举类型构造类型有:数组类型、结构体类型、共用体类型
Ⅱ c语言中做33lU或33Lu对吗
此处两者效果一样,但是一般建议写成大写的,以防止把小写l和数字1混淆
Ⅲ C语言中的短整形后缀h和十六进制的后缀h不是重复了吗,如:72lu(长整+无
你学得太多了,把好多不同领域的概念弄一起了!C中十六进制数据不需要用h或H作后缀,所以h后缀表示短整型是独一无二的,不产生混淆!
Ⅳ lu在c语言中是不是无符号长整型的缩写
对的 。。
比如用在printf中,%lu
Ⅳ C语言中%p,%u,%lu都有什么用处
C语言“格式控制字符”:p是pointer(指针缩写);u是unsigned(无符号的)缩写无正负号
1. %p会把值作为一个地址输出。
2. %u对int型和unsigned int型都可以,表示输入输出格式为无符号int型。
3. %lu对unsigned long型,无符号长整数型。
%p举例:int i=0; printf("%p",&i); 执行结果: 0xbffb2d6a 。%p是将&i这个值作为地址输出,并以0x开头16进制类型输出出来。
%u举例: int a=-1; unsigned int b ;
b=a; printf("%d\t %u\t %d\t %u",a,a,b,b); \\ \t是制表符,
执行结果:-1 4294967295 -1 4294967295
Ⅵ c语言中%lu的含义什么
c语言中%lu的含义:long unsigned数据类型无符号长整数或无符号长浮点数,就比如int型是%d一样。
Ⅶ C语言printf(“%017lu”,A+B+C+D+E+F+G)函数,输出的结果是不是等于D+E+F+G,为什么
不是的,是因为你那数字太大,溢出了,只是留下的是一样的。数字小一些就看出来了——
看,不一样吧?
Ⅷ C语言 void luru(int i,struct s a[])什么意思
你的代码含义模糊,而且main里面未曾调用,貌似luru函数是个给s的结构数组a每个成员输入fanghao, 这里应该是房号的意思吧,假设a是房间的结构数组的话,简单来说luru函数的作用就是给每个房间编号,但实际上函数会掉入死循环。。
Ⅸ C语言,请问常量-012和65535LU是不是合法
012是八进制数,不允许加负号的,不合法
65535LU合法,是无符号长整型常量